What is Sinusitis?

Typically, a bad cold often gets regarded as a sinus infection. Several symptoms help people to detect this issue. However, a sinus infection is the result of a bacterial infection. The fungi and molds cause it. Patients who suffer from a weak immune system will develop this bacterial infection more. Other people have allergies and can have different symptoms. If you have an acute sinus infection, it might last for eight weeks as well.

Simply put, sinuses are known as the air-filled cavities. They are situated:

  • Inside the bone structures of our cheeks
  • On the side of nose bridges
  • Behind the eyebrows and forehead
  • Behind our nose and right in front of our brain

The symptoms

  • Some of the most notable symptoms for Sinusitis are as follows:
  • Face tenderness, especially in the under-eye region
  • Frontal headaches
  • Nasal congestion
  • Bad breath
  • Pain in the teeth
  • Fever
  • Discolored nasal discharge
  • Fatigue
  • Coughing
  • Postnasal drip

The probable treatment

Various treatments are applicable to cure Sinusitis. Some of the important ones are as follows:

Antibiotics

It is a standard treatment for any bacterial sinus infection. You need to take these antibiotics for a stretch of three to twenty-eight days, based on the medicines you need to take. Also, since the sinuses get deeply attached to the bones, and there is restricted blood supply, the treatment might take longer to get over.

Sometimes, people who use antibiotics excessively often experience antibiotic resistance. Hence, if the symptoms persist for over seven and ten days, only then should the patient’s take antibiotics. The antibiotics can minimize sinus infection by reducing the bacteria. But you have to choose the correct drug, and else the symptoms will persist. Hence, it is essential to opt-in for the right medical specialist who can guide you accordingly.

The nasal sprays

You can opt-in for the nasal sprays that help in decongesting the tracks. However, you shouldn’t use it for more than three to four days. Medicines will eventually shrink swollen nasal passages that in turn facilitate the flow from the sinuses. Like antibiotics, you shouldn’t be making excessive use of the topical nasal decongestants that can lead to a rebound phenomenon. Hence, it is essential to use a balanced dosage.

Antihistamines

The Antihistamines help to block any inflammation that gets caused by an allergic reaction. It can combat any allergy symptoms that will result in swollen sinus and nasal passages.
